摘 要:垫状驼绒藜(Krascheninnikovia compacta)群落分布于人迹罕至的极端寒冷、干旱的高海拔地区,是青藏高原高寒荒漠最为典型且分布较广的植被类型。该群落已有的研究多为定性描述,均未提供珍贵的样方数据。本文以2018、2019及2022年野外调查数据和相关文献资料为基础,记录整理了垫状驼绒藜群落的空间分布、群落特征、群落结构及其气候等环境特征,构建了垫状驼绒藜群落数据集。数据集结果显示:(1)垫状驼绒藜群落主要分布在青藏高原的中昆仑山、北天山、阿尔金山、当金山山口;(2)垫状驼绒藜群落的高度、盖度、生物量和物种丰富度均相对较低,22个典型样地共记录到种子植物29种,分属11科22属;其生活型以地面芽植物居多,共18种,占植物总种数的62.07%,主要为多年生禾草和多年生杂类草;(3)群落结构简单,恒有度>50%的仅有垫状驼绒藜,灌木层、草本层都未出现次优势种,伴生种、偶见种居多(93.10%);(4)群落垂直结构可划分为2层,第一层是以垫状驼绒藜为主的稀疏垫状小半灌木,第二层是稀疏的草本层;(5)群落的生长环境具有气候寒冷、降水少且集中于最暖季的高寒荒漠气候特点。本数据集是国内目前已知唯一垫状驼绒藜群落数据集,是揭示垫状驼绒藜群落物种组成和结构等特征的重要凭证,数据集中的地理气候信息和群落物种信息可为垫状驼绒藜群落研究及《中国植被志》的编研提供基础数据。The Krascheninnikovia compacta community is primarily distributed in extremely cold and arid high-altitude environments typically inaccessible to humans.It represents the most common and widely distributed type of vegetation in the alpine deserts of the Qingzang Plateau.Most investigations into this community take the form of qualitative descriptions,which fail to provide precious sample data.In order to generate a community dataset of K.compacta,this paper recorded and organized the spatial distribution,community characteristics and structure,and climate characteristics of this species based on field survey data collected in 2018,2019,and 2022,along with a description of the relevant literature.The results showed that:(1)Krascheninnikovia compacta community was mainly found in the Central Kunlun Mountains of the Qingzang Plateau,the Northern Tianshan Mountains,the Altun Mountains,and the Dangjin Mountains Pass.(2)Krascheninnikovia compacta community had the relatively low values in community height,coverage,biomass and species richness.Our study identified 29 species of seed plants belonging to 11 families and 22 genera distributed among 22 typical plots.Hemicryptophytes were the dominant life form,with a total of 18 species,which accounted for 62.07%of all plants and primarily consisted of perennial grasses and perennial weeds.(3)The community structure was relatively simple due to only K.compacta having a consistent presence of more than 50%of all species.There were several subdominant species but mostly companion species and occasional species(93.10%)residing in the shrub layer and herb layer.(4)The vertical structure of the community can be divided into two layers.The first layer consists of a sparse cushioned small semi-shrub dominated by K.compacta,and the second layer consists of a sparse herb layer.(5)The growth environment of this community was characterized by a cold climate and little precipitation that is concentrated in the warmest quarter of the alpine desert climate.This dataset is the only known
